Cargando...
Comment
"Mallorca may be cut off from much of the world, but why not look to the mainland?"
Humphrey Carter06/01/2021 13:47
Comment
Mallorca’s digital chance
"Mallorca may be cut off from much of the world, but why not look to the mainland?"
Humphrey Carter06/01/2021 13:47